This is as discussed on wine-devel. I think this will make 'ok' much
more consistent with all our other APIs.

I refined the script because it was not good enough. It had problems
with format strings that contained a comma, for instance "failed,
error=%ld", and with tests that call an API with a string as parameter,
for instance ok(FooA(0,"toto",NULL)==2,"blah blah"). The updated script
contains a recursive descent micro parser that handles both of the above
without any problem. The hardest part was actually convincing myself the
parser approach was the way to go.

So here is how to make the switch:
 * apply the patch
   This fixes the winetest_ok implementation, and fixes three tests that
define macros around 'ok' and thus cannot be handled by the script.
 * run the script
   This fixes all other calls to ok, generating an 8500 lines diff. I
checked the diff visually and it looks nice. Also, this time I made sure
I could recompile the tests and also run them once modified and both
worked fine.
